**Memo to Branch Managers**

Quick one: we're putting in a budget request for the Hollowpine refit programme — new counters, signage, the works. Finance wants branch-level usage numbers by Friday, so please send yours to Priya. Keep estimates honest; padding got us burned last year. Before you circulate anything, note the following.

board note of bajop-yaweg: The western region missed its Pelys quota by 58.0 percent last quarter. Pelysek Foods plans to raise the Belius list price by 44.0 percent in July. The steering committee signed off on a budget of $133.8 million for Project Pelax. The renewal with Zoraelix Systems closes at $61.9 million a year, 12.7 percent above the last contract.

## Further reading

Hot-reloading in Quillbase watches the config bundle and applies changes without a process restart. Most keys reload cleanly; connection-pool sizes and TLS settings still require a rolling restart, which trips people up at least once a quarter. The reload path also validates schemas before swap, so malformed pushes fail closed. For the sync discussion, the list of reloadable keys, restart-required keys, and rollout timing lives on this page.

runbook for badug-kadup: https://confluence.zemvarlabs.internal/projects/browse/display/projects/bd1b

## Formula sandbox tuning

User-supplied formulas in Gridmoor execute inside a restricted interpreter with hard ceilings on time, memory, and call depth. Reviewers should confirm any change to these ceilings is justified in the PR description, since raising them widens the abuse surface. Defaults were chosen from production traces. The current limits are as follows.

limits module of tafog-fawip:
WEIGHTS = {
    "julix": 57,
    "lamys": 992,
    "kasvan": 209,
    "quenok": 750,
    "alddor": 259,
    "oliath": 1009,
    "wenix": 815,
}

Cache invalidation in the Shelfstone catalog API is event-driven: any write to a product record publishes an invalidation message, and edge caches must drop the affected keys within five seconds. Never invalidate by pattern; always use explicit key lists, as wildcard purges have previously evicted the whole catalog. Manual purges go through the internal purge service, which requires the key below.

app token of tadug-yahag = vxb3-949